KubeHA is an advanced AI tool designed to automate incident response and recovery for Kubernetes clusters. It leverages Generative AI to provide deep contextual insights into alerts, analyze root causes, and execute automated remediation actions, significantly reducing manual operational overhead. This solution is ideal for DevOps, SRE, and platform engineering teams looking to enhance the reliability and availability of their Kubernetes environments by streamlining incident management and minimizing Mean Time To Recovery (MTTR).

KubeHA integrates with existing observability stacks to ingest alerts, logs, and metrics from Kubernetes clusters. Its Generative AI engine then analyzes this data to pinpoint the root cause of issues and generate precise, actionable remediation plans. Finally, it automatically executes pre-approved actions to resolve incidents, transforming reactive alert management into proactive, self-healing operations.
